Как функционирует шифрование информации

Как функционирует шифрование информации

Кодирование данных представляет собой процесс преобразования данных в нечитаемый формы. Первоначальный текст зовётся незашифрованным, а закодированный — шифротекстом. Трансформация выполняется с помощью алгоритма и ключа. Ключ является собой уникальную последовательность символов.

Механизм шифрования начинается с применения математических вычислений к данным. Алгоритм модифицирует построение сведений согласно определённым нормам. Итог делается бесполезным сочетанием символов 1хбет казино для внешнего наблюдателя. Расшифровка доступна только при присутствии правильного ключа.

Современные системы защиты применяют комплексные вычислительные функции. Взломать качественное шифрование без ключа фактически невозможно. Технология охраняет коммуникацию, финансовые операции и персональные файлы пользователей.

Что такое криптография и зачем она требуется

Криптография является собой науку о методах защиты информации от незаконного проникновения. Область изучает способы разработки алгоритмов для обеспечения конфиденциальности информации. Криптографические способы применяются для разрешения задач безопасности в виртуальной среде.

Основная цель криптографии состоит в защите секретности сообщений при отправке по незащищённым каналам. Технология гарантирует, что только авторизованные получатели сумеют прочесть содержимое. Криптография также обеспечивает целостность данных 1хбет казино и подтверждает подлинность отправителя.

Современный виртуальный мир невозможен без криптографических технологий. Финансовые транзакции нуждаются надёжной охраны финансовых сведений клиентов. Цифровая корреспонденция требует в кодировании для обеспечения конфиденциальности. Облачные сервисы используют шифрование для защиты документов.

Криптография решает задачу проверки сторон общения. Технология позволяет удостовериться в аутентичности партнёра или источника документа. Электронные подписи основаны на криптографических основах и имеют юридической значимостью 1хбет зеркало во многих странах.

Охрана личных сведений превратилась крайне важной задачей для компаний. Криптография предотвращает хищение личной данных преступниками. Технология гарантирует безопасность медицинских данных и коммерческой секрета компаний.

Главные типы шифрования

Имеется два основных типа кодирования: симметричное и асимметричное. Симметрическое кодирование применяет один ключ для кодирования и декодирования данных. Отправитель и адресат обязаны иметь идентичный тайный ключ.

Симметрические алгоритмы функционируют оперативно и эффективно обслуживают значительные массивы данных. Главная проблема состоит в безопасной отправке ключа между сторонами. Если преступник перехватит ключ 1xbet casino во время передачи, защита будет нарушена.

Асимметрическое кодирование использует комплект математически взаимосвязанных ключей. Публичный ключ используется для кодирования данных и доступен всем. Приватный ключ используется для расшифровки и хранится в секрете.

Достоинство асимметрической криптографии состоит в отсутствии потребности отправлять тайный ключ. Источник кодирует данные открытым ключом адресата. Декодировать данные может только владелец подходящего закрытого ключа 1хбет казино из пары.

Гибридные системы совмещают оба метода для получения оптимальной эффективности. Асимметрическое кодирование применяется для безопасного обмена симметрическим ключом. Затем симметрический алгоритм обрабатывает главный объём данных благодаря большой скорости.

Выбор вида зависит от требований безопасности и производительности. Каждый способ имеет уникальными характеристиками и областями применения.

Сопоставление симметрического и асимметричного шифрования

Симметричное кодирование характеризуется большой производительностью обработки информации. Алгоритмы требуют минимальных процессорных ресурсов для кодирования крупных файлов. Способ годится для охраны информации на дисках и в базах.

Асимметричное кодирование функционирует медленнее из-за комплексных математических вычислений. Процессорная нагрузка возрастает при увеличении объёма информации. Технология используется для отправки небольших массивов критически значимой информации 1xbet casino между участниками.

Управление ключами представляет основное различие между методами. Симметрические системы нуждаются защищённого соединения для передачи тайного ключа. Асимметрические способы разрешают задачу через публикацию открытых ключей.

Длина ключа влияет на степень безопасности механизма. Симметрические алгоритмы применяют ключи длиной 128-256 бит. Асимметрическое кодирование требует ключи длиной 2048-4096 бит 1икс бет казино для аналогичной надёжности.

Масштабируемость различается в зависимости от количества участников. Симметрическое шифрование требует индивидуального ключа для каждой комплекта участников. Асимметричный подход даёт использовать единую комплект ключей для общения со всеми.

Как действует SSL/TLS безопасность

SSL и TLS являются собой протоколы шифровальной защиты для защищённой передачи информации в интернете. TLS является современной версией старого протокола SSL. Технология гарантирует конфиденциальность и неизменность информации между пользователем и сервером.

Процесс создания безопасного соединения стартует с рукопожатия между сторонами. Клиент посылает запрос на соединение и получает сертификат от сервера. Сертификат включает открытый ключ и сведения о обладателе ресурса 1xbet casino для верификации аутентичности.

Браузер проверяет достоверность сертификата через последовательность авторизованных центров сертификации. Проверка удостоверяет, что сервер действительно принадлежит указанному владельцу. После успешной проверки стартует обмен криптографическими настройками для создания защищённого соединения.

Стороны определяют симметрический ключ сессии с помощью асимметричного кодирования. Клиент создаёт случайный ключ и кодирует его открытым ключом сервера. Только сервер может расшифровать данные своим закрытым ключом 1икс бет казино и получить ключ сеанса.

Последующий обмен информацией происходит с использованием симметричного шифрования и согласованного ключа. Такой метод обеспечивает большую производительность передачи данных при сохранении защиты. Стандарт защищает онлайн-платежи, аутентификацию пользователей и конфиденциальную коммуникацию в интернете.

Алгоритмы кодирования информации

Криптографические алгоритмы являются собой вычислительные методы преобразования данных для гарантирования безопасности. Различные алгоритмы применяются в зависимости от критериев к скорости и безопасности.

  1. AES является эталоном симметричного кодирования и используется правительственными организациями. Алгоритм обеспечивает ключи длиной 128, 192 и 256 бит для разных уровней безопасности систем.
  2. RSA является собой асимметрический алгоритм, базирующийся на сложности факторизации больших чисел. Метод применяется для цифровых подписей и безопасного передачи ключами.
  3. SHA-256 принадлежит к семейству хеш-функций и создаёт уникальный отпечаток данных постоянной длины. Алгоритм используется для проверки целостности файлов и хранения паролей.
  4. ChaCha20 представляет современным потоковым шифром с высокой производительностью на портативных гаджетах. Алгоритм обеспечивает качественную защиту при небольшом расходе мощностей.

Подбор алгоритма зависит от специфики задачи и критериев защиты программы. Сочетание методов повышает уровень безопасности системы.

Где применяется шифрование

Финансовый сегмент применяет шифрование для охраны финансовых операций пользователей. Онлайн-платежи проходят через защищённые соединения с применением современных алгоритмов. Платёжные карты содержат зашифрованные данные для предотвращения обмана.

Мессенджеры применяют сквозное шифрование для обеспечения приватности переписки. Данные шифруются на гаджете источника и декодируются только у получателя. Операторы не имеют доступа к содержимому коммуникаций 1хбет казино благодаря защите.

Цифровая корреспонденция использует стандарты кодирования для безопасной отправки писем. Деловые системы охраняют секретную коммерческую данные от перехвата. Технология предотвращает прочтение данных третьими сторонами.

Виртуальные сервисы кодируют документы клиентов для охраны от утечек. Файлы шифруются перед отправкой на серверы оператора. Доступ обретает только обладатель с корректным ключом.

Медицинские организации используют шифрование для защиты цифровых записей пациентов. Шифрование пресекает неавторизованный проникновение к врачебной информации.

Угрозы и уязвимости систем кодирования

Слабые пароли являются значительную опасность для криптографических систем защиты. Пользователи выбирают простые сочетания знаков, которые просто угадываются злоумышленниками. Нападения перебором взламывают качественные алгоритмы при предсказуемых ключах.

Ошибки в внедрении протоколов создают уязвимости в безопасности данных. Программисты создают ошибки при создании программы кодирования. Некорректная настройка параметров снижает результативность 1икс бет казино системы безопасности.

Нападения по побочным каналам позволяют извлекать тайные ключи без прямого компрометации. Преступники исследуют время выполнения операций, потребление или электромагнитное излучение прибора. Физический доступ к оборудованию увеличивает риски взлома.

Квантовые системы являются возможную опасность для асимметрических алгоритмов. Вычислительная производительность квантовых компьютеров способна взломать RSA и иные способы. Исследовательское сообщество создаёт постквантовые алгоритмы для борьбы угрозам.

Социальная инженерия обходит технологические средства через манипулирование людьми. Злоумышленники обретают доступ к ключам посредством обмана пользователей. Человеческий элемент остаётся уязвимым звеном защиты.

Перспективы криптографических решений

Квантовая криптография открывает возможности для абсолютно защищённой передачи информации. Технология основана на принципах квантовой механики. Любая попытка захвата меняет состояние квантовых частиц и обнаруживается механизмом.

Постквантовые алгоритмы разрабатываются для защиты от будущих квантовых систем. Математические способы разрабатываются с учётом вычислительных возможностей квантовых компьютеров. Компании внедряют новые стандарты для длительной безопасности.

Гомоморфное кодирование даёт производить вычисления над закодированными информацией без расшифровки. Технология решает проблему обслуживания секретной информации в виртуальных сервисах. Результаты остаются защищёнными на протяжении всего процедуры 1xbet casino обработки.

Блокчейн-технологии интегрируют шифровальные методы для распределённых механизмов хранения. Цифровые подписи обеспечивают неизменность данных в цепочке блоков. Децентрализованная архитектура повышает надёжность механизмов.

Искусственный интеллект применяется для исследования протоколов и обнаружения уязвимостей. Машинное обучение способствует разрабатывать стойкие алгоритмы шифрования.